While kids across the world learn English in addition to other foreign languages since the time they enter elementary school (or earlier), most native-English speakers never get past elementary foreign language skills if they learn any at all.

But research shows that learning a second language as a child is not only good for working and traveling later as an adult, it is also excellent for developing the young brain.
